There has been many inquiries about my 1058.8 and 1201 Dueck. The 1058.8 was
the 898 Knauss x 805 Pukos and the 1201 was the reverse cross. The 1201 had
only 2 seeds in her. I'm happy to say the 1058.8 had 600 good seeds in her.
The 898 was the female which produced the 1058.8 and went 2 percent heavy.
The 805 was the male which produced the 1201 which went 14 percent heavy.
For those who are looking for heavy genes this looks good on paper. But only
time will tell.

buyHi Guys! This should help those who are new to the sport -
SASBE and SASBP are growers' shorthand for self-addressed stamped bubble
envelope/self-addressed stamped bubble pack.
1. Go to the drug store, stationery store, five-&-dime, or wal*mart andbubble-padded envelopes in two sizes. Be sure the small one fits insidethebig one.the
2. Address the small envelope to yourself and the large one to the grower.
3a. If you're crossing national borders, tuck in a couple of dollars to
cover postage costs.
3b. Within the same country, just affix the correct amount of postage tosmall envelope.
4. Tuck the small envelope into the large one, affix the proper postage
thereon, send it off.
5. Be patient. Mail can be slow.
